detection of deltamethrin resistance in cattle tick, rhipicephalus microplus collected in western haryana state of india

Background: out of 931 species of ticks, rhipicephalus microplus is the most widely studied tick species due to its pivotal role in transmission of babesiosis and anaplasmosis, resulting in huge economic loss in cattle and buffalo’s industry. chemical control using deltamethrin forms the mainstay of tick control strategy because of high potency and low toxicity. however, inadvertent use of deltamethrin has led to the development of deltamethrin resistance in field ticks methods: the engorged female ticks were collected in a plastic container covered with a cotton plug from 10 places (jarwa, barwa, khajakhera, banisi, nakipur, dhangar, badopal, shivalya dharamshala, siwani and meham) of five districts of western haryana. the larval packet test (lpt) was conducted for the characterization of resistance in field tick. results: in the present study, ticks were collected from 10 places from 5 districts of western haryana and evaluated against deltamethrin using larval packed test. the lc50 values (confidence interval) of ticks larvae against deltamethrin collected from nakipur, dhangar, barwa, badopal, shivalya dharamshala, siwani, jarwa, khajakhera, meham and banisi are 73.6 (67.2–81.9), 61.2 (61.6–98.5), 52.7 (14.4–101.0), 140.0 (86.7–448.6), 65.8 (37.1–95.2), 232.1 (201.0–304.7), 3.72 (0.20–9.87), 21.3 (12.0–31.6), 107.6 (96.8–127.6), 54.2 (43.4–58.4) ppm, respectively. the resistance factor ranges from 0.31 to 11.86, indicating variable resistance among field isolates. conclusion: data generated on deltamethrin resistance status in r. microplus from haryana, india can be used as an indicator for the management of the species in the state.
